๐Ÿšซ Ingredients to Avoid Around Your Eye Area

The skin around your brows is thin and delicate, so be especially cautious with:

Fragrance / Parfum
Essential oils (e.g., lavender, citrus, peppermint)
Tocopheryl / Vitamin E (if you react to it)
Propylene glycol
Alcohols / denatured alcohol
Harsh preservatives (e.g., formaldehyde-releasers)

Even products labeled “natural” can contain sensitizing ingredients, so always check the label, especially if you already have known triggers.


✅ What to Look For in Allergy-Friendly Brow Products

When shopping for brow makeup, choose formulas that are:

Fragrance-free (not just “unscented”)
Minimal ingredient lists
Ophthalmologist-tested / safe near eyes
Hypoallergenic
Free from lotions or heavy oils around the brow line

If a brow product is tested for use on eyelids or near eyes, that’s usually a good sign for sensitive skin.

๐ŸŽจ Tips for Sensitive Skin When Using Brow Products

Patch test first: Always test new brow makeup on a small area near your jaw or behind your ear before using it near your eyes.
Start subtle: Light strokes help avoid irritation and build color naturally.
Use clean tools: Brushes and spoolies can harbor bacteria so wash them weekly.
Remove gently: Use a fragrance-free makeup remover and avoid harsh rubbing.
Take breaks: If your brows feel irritated, skip makeup for a day or two to let the skin recover.
